How to compare dates in a sql script to progress database?

    We have a field in our progress database which is DATETIME-TZ so an example of the data is "23/05/2019 12:11:16.099" - I'm need some help to compare dates in this field with an SQL select statement

    In progress procedure editor, I can compare dates easily, for example

    select date(bond-no) from accadd where date(bond-no) <= Today

    This works perfectly, but i need to get this info via sql for a web page and just get an error, even breaking the field down as a substring and making the date back up doesn't seem to work

    SELECT date(""bond-no"") FROM accadd WHERE date(""bond-no"") <= Date()

    Have tried variations on the above and this too...

    DATE(SUBSTRING(""bond-no"",4,2),SUBSTRING(""bond-no"",1,2),SUBSTRING(""bond-no"",7,4))

    This should return just dates earlier than today, but just get the old syntax incorrect message, so i'm missing something somewhere

    [DataDirect][ODBC Progress OpenEdge Wire Protocol driver][OPENEDGE]Syntax error in SQL statement at or about ") FROM accadd WHERE" (10713)
